New book: NICK CAVE & THE BAD SEEDS; AN ART BOOK

Following Reinhard Kleist’s international bestselling graphic novel Nick Cave: Mercy On Me, which was endorsed by the songwriter himself, this beautifully produced coffee table book brings together the German artist’s moody and expressive portraits of the musician and his band. It covers 30 years of writing, recording and live performance. Evoking memories of songs and concerts, it’s full of visual delights that celebrate Nick Cave’s incredible career, creating a kaleidoscopic portrait of the storyteller, musician and cultural icon. Featuring brush pen sketches, full-colour portraits and comic book reimaginings of Cave’s songs, this LP-sized art book highlights the German graphic novelist’s extraordinary craftsmanship.

About Reinhard Kleist

Reinhard Kleist is an award-winning graphic novelist best known for his graphic biographies Johnny Cash: I See A Darkness, The Boxer, Castro and An Olympic Dream, all published by SelfMadeHero. He lives in Berlin.
